Operational Costs Are Increasing Faster Than Revenue
When operational costs become unsustainable, it’s time to consider alternatives. According to Deloitte’s Global Outsourcing Survey, nearly 70% of businesses outsource to reduce costs. By delegating specific tasks, you can eliminate expenses related to hiring, training, and maintaining an in-house team. For example, outsourcing your IT support can save you up to 30-40% in operational costs, allowing you to invest those savings into other growth areas.

Facing Hiring Challenges
Recruitment challenges are becoming a reality with an ever-widening talent gap, especially in the IT and customer service spaces. Korn Ferry’s research estimates a global shortfall of talent to reach 85 million by the year 2030. If your business is facing challenges in recruiting skilled employees for specialized roles, leveraging external resources can provide an effective solution. BPO providers helps mitigate recruitment challenges with the right talent at the right time.
Need Access to the Latest Technology and Expertise
In an industry where technological innovation is constantly evolving, keeping up can be overwhelming. Outsourcing offers a way forward by providing access to advanced technology and expertise that might be out of reach for your business. A 2023 Statista study shows that 60% of companies outsource for technological access. Whether it’s AI-powered analytics or cloud-based solutions, these partnerships can give your business the competitive edge it needs. With the IT outsourcing market poised to hit US$591.24 billion by 2025, it’s time to tap into these resources for business growth.
